Why capacity governance is the hidden constraint in manufacturing ERP partnerships
Manufacturing ERP projects are operationally sensitive. They often involve production planning, procurement, inventory control, warehouse processes, quality management, maintenance coordination, finance, and reporting. A partner may close a deal based on strong domain credibility, but if it lacks governed capacity across functional consulting, technical integration, cloud operations, and post-go-live support, the project becomes vulnerable. Delays increase, scope control weakens, and customer confidence declines.
Capacity governance is the discipline of matching demand, skills, environments, and service commitments to a realistic delivery model. It requires visibility into pipeline quality, implementation complexity, specialist availability, onboarding lead times, cloud deployment patterns, and support obligations. In manufacturing, this also includes plant calendars, seasonal demand cycles, cutover windows, and business continuity constraints. Without this governance layer, partner ecosystems tend to overcommit in sales and underdeliver in execution.

Choosing the right business model: project revenue, subscription revenue, or hybrid
Manufacturing ERP partnerships often begin with implementation-led revenue, but long-term enterprise value is usually created through hybrid models that combine project services with recurring subscriptions. The right model depends on customer buying preferences, partner cash flow tolerance, cloud operating maturity, and the degree of standardization in the solution portfolio.
| Model | Advantages | Trade-offs |
|---|---|---|
| Project-led implementation | Fast cash realization and familiar sales motion | Revenue volatility, lower valuation quality, limited post-go-live stickiness |
| Subscription-led White-label SaaS | Predictable recurring revenue and stronger customer lifetime value | Requires operational maturity, support readiness, and disciplined service packaging |
| Hybrid project plus managed services | Balances upfront services with recurring margin expansion | Needs clear pricing architecture and lifecycle governance |
| Infrastructure-based Pricing | Aligns cloud cost recovery with usage and deployment complexity | Can become difficult to forecast without strong observability and cost controls |
For many ERP Partners and MSPs, the hybrid model is the most practical path. It allows implementation services to fund customer acquisition while Managed Cloud Services, support retainers, analytics, workflow automation, and customer success programs build recurring revenue over time. This also creates a more resilient business than relying on new project bookings alone.
Capacity governance starts with architecture standardization
Partners cannot scale manufacturing ERP delivery if every deployment is architected as a custom environment. Standardization is not the enemy of flexibility; it is the foundation that makes controlled flexibility possible. A partner should define reference architectures for Multi-tenant SaaS, Dedicated SaaS, Private Cloud, and Hybrid Cloud deployments, then map customer profiles to those patterns based on compliance, integration complexity, performance isolation, and commercial requirements.
Multi-tenant SaaS can support efficient onboarding, lower operational overhead, and standardized release management for customers with common requirements. Dedicated cloud deployments are often better suited to manufacturers with stricter isolation, custom integration patterns, or specific governance needs. Hybrid Cloud strategies may be appropriate where plant systems, legacy applications, or data residency considerations require a mixed operating model. The key is to avoid treating every customer as a special case unless the business case clearly justifies it.
Cloud-native operations also matter. Platform Engineering practices, containerization with technologies such as Kubernetes and Docker where appropriate, managed data services such as PostgreSQL and Redis when relevant to the platform design, and API-first architecture can all improve repeatability. However, these choices should be driven by operational outcomes, not technical fashion. The objective is faster provisioning, safer change management, stronger resilience, and lower support complexity.

Common mistakes in manufacturing ERP partnership scaling
The most common mistake is treating implementation capacity as a staffing issue rather than a governance issue. Hiring more consultants does not solve weak scoping, inconsistent architecture, poor onboarding, or unclear service boundaries. Another frequent error is pursuing every manufacturing opportunity regardless of fit. Capacity governance requires selective growth. Not every prospect should be accepted if the deployment model, timeline, or support expectations are misaligned with the partner's operating model.
A third mistake is separating implementation from long-term service design. If support, cloud operations, and customer success are added only after go-live, the partner loses pricing leverage and operational coherence. Finally, some firms over-customize too early. Excessive customization may help close a deal, but it often undermines scalability, upgradeability, and margin. In manufacturing, disciplined configuration and integration strategy usually create better long-term economics than bespoke development.
